Learn the basics of building small structures. Then maybe a fixed drilling platform. Then maybe vehicles / flying machines.
Then you could look at automating things through Event controllers, sensors, timer blocks.
Then maybe start looking at the AI blocks.
Start off small.

Which brings up another thing: the game changes over time (most major updates add functionality), so try and watch the most recent tutorials on more complex topics.
The workshop is amazing, but I'd recommend you avoid mods at the start until you're familiar with the game, as some might cause confusion as to what is built-in and what's from the mod. The one exception I'd recommend is "colorful icons", as it's enormously visually helpful and doesn't change any controls or anything like that.
Once you're a bit more familiar with the game and controls, add Air Leak Finder and Build Info (both by the same guy) are incredible. The Air Leak Finder does exactly what it says. You turn it on from a vent and it'll guide you to the leak. Build Info has lots of overlays you can cycle through and lots of info even when overlays are turned off... so you can see how strong a block is, how much mass it has, what sides are sealed against leaks, what sides are attachment points, tons of useful info. For things that generate or consume power, it even tells you how much! No more navigating to the wiki to figure out how much power a thruster uses or how much a battery provides when building your craft.
The only time I've had trouble converting something from a station to a ship was when I parked too close to the voxels. The solution was to grind the voxels away from the cubes that defines the blocks' locations (worked perfectly). It's very repeatable.
